Im strongly considering investing in a Kifaru 20* slick bag but am curious how it compares with my current bag, which is a USGI intermediate bag.

Does anybody have both that can compare them in warmth?

I have a good amount of experience with USGI bags and now own a kifaru 20* bag. The comparison is not fair honestly, the kifaru is warmer, roomier and packs smaller. If you have been getting by with the USGI bag the switch will leave you glad you spent the extra money.
